A key considerations involved in outdoor electronic signage setup continues to be placement planning and audience visibility. Strategic location of the digital display should align with foot movement, automobile driver visibility, plus typical viewing distance range. Screen dimensions, pixel density, and brightness specifications need to align with the immediate location to help ensure messages stays readable under full sunlight and nighttime situations. Light glare reduction, audience viewing lines of sight, as well as nearby structures also influence viewer engagement. Effective location preparation helps achieve strong communication distribution while also supporting conformity with applicable city land-use as well as outdoor signage codes.
Outdoor defense continues to be another critical aspect of outdoor digital signage installations. Displays must remain fully installed inside durable cases built specifically to handle precipitation, particulates, dampness, as well as temperature extremes. Adequate dust and water rating classifications, cooling features, along with cooling regulation systems this content are designed to limit heat buildup along with system wear. Mounting strength remains also important, as support equipment needs to withstand environmental pressures along with motion over extended durations. All of these safeguarding measures increase system useful life while minimize the risk of system interruptions.
Power-related plus connectivity systems perform a critical purpose in supporting dependable electronic display performance. Outdoor deployments demand secure electrical supply, electrical grounding designs, along with power surge defense so as to shield from power fluctuations. Connectivity reliability, whether through hardwired or wireless connections, should enable continuous information transfer to support message refreshes along with software tracking. Media development plus service scheduling support any external networked advertising implementation. Content should be carefully developed for quick interpretation, with the use of suitable text dimensions, visibility contrast, and motion management designed for audience. Scheduled inspection plans, such as platform upgrades, hardware inspections, plus surface cleaning, work to preserve visual performance and network stability. System oversight systems can detect problems early and facilitate early service actions.
